A facebook post by Multimedia’s Joy News channel showing the arrival of Lawra Senior High School’s participants for the National Science and Maths Quiz 2019 has generated an uproar on the social media platform.
Joy News, official television Broadcast house for the competition apparently only found it necessary to post a picture of the five boys of Lawra SHS taken during their arrival for the Quiz in Accra. The post which is captioned ” 2019 NSMQ: The Arrival of Lawra SHS” shows the boys carrying their luggage in their school-shorts, flip-flops ( Chalewote), and house vests, looking weary from a long bus journey from Lawra in the Upper West region.
Though, Joy News has not stated any other reasons for specific post about the Lawra boys, many Ghanaians have brought them under fire on Facebook saying it was an intentional post to ridicule and undermine boys to the public.
One Facebook user commented that “Good luck guys,Joy News decided to put this particular picture with an intention to make a mockery of you. I don’t know any of you but you are winners already. May God see you through “.
Another User says ” intelligence is not physically displayed, don’t make mockery of people’s condition”.
